Mythbusting

Superfoods, Silkworms, and Spandex: Science and Pseudoscience in Everyday Life
Joe Schwarcz
ECW Press
260 pages, softcover and ebook

Book after book, Joe Schwarcz wants to make the world more logical. With his latest, Superfoods, Silkworms, and Spandex, the McGill University chemistry professor dissects seventy-five phenomenons, theories, and eve…
